Purpose of Job
As a Recruitment Partner here, you’ll build robust relationships with clients and vendors alike. We’ll look to you to build end-to-end recruitment cycles for every role, whether permanent or temporary, and to support internal mobility too. It makes this a great opportunity for someone who’s hungry to make their mark. You’ll help us redefine the way recruitment works.
Responsibilities:
Line Manager Relationship Management
- Meet up with line managers to discuss new opportunities and decide upon resourcing strategies
- Provide regular market information using both internal and external sources
- Help us to create jobs specs that are fully in line with legislative requirements
- Talk about the benefits of our processes and direct recruitment with line managers, especially in terms of clients saving money and getting added value
- Build and maintain strong client relationships
- Provide credible and consultative advice throughout the entire recruitment lifecycle
- Maintain the agreed Service Level Agreements with the client
- Liaise with client managers at all levels to so you can keep track of and influence business plans, recruitment plans and organisational structures
- Be the key interface between the client HR and line management teams and our own managers
- Help people within the team to develop new skills, share their knowledge and stay up-to-speed with industry developments
- Support the sharing of information between line managers, vendor management and our direct recruitment team
Recruitment Process Management
- Manage and deliver a reactive volume recruitment service
- Provide a true partnership by thinking strategically and going above and beyond to get things done
- Work with approved vendors to source candidates
- Arrange agency briefings to help us streamline our processes
- Provide a weekly live job report to agencies with status updates on all roles
- Screen CVs, arrange initial interviews and carry out final round interviews if needed – you’ll also need to keep records of the process
- Manage offers – including providing up-to-date salary and market information (especially based on any recent new hires in the organisation)
- Manage internal and external advertising
- Oversee vendors to help with external sourcing and best practice approaches
- Give candidate feedback, liaising with client line managers
Process and Procedures
- Ensure compliance with our Service Level Agreements and all client policies, from approval systems to cost management
- Develop and deliver business plans, recruitment strategies and resourcing ideas
- Implement simple, effective, and trackable resourcing, record keeping and administration processes
- Produce and develop regular and meaningful reports for the client and our senior management team
- Make sure our invoicing processes are always efficient and effective
